The impact of board gender diversity on the Gulf Cooperation Council’s reporting on sustainable development goals

Saeed Alshaiba,
Bashar Abu Khalaf

Abstract: The topic of gender diversity on corporate boards is becoming increasingly significant globally, particularly in the Gulf Cooperation Council (GCC) region. Investors are progressively taking environmental, social, and governance (ESG) considerations, such as gender diversity and sustainability reporting when making investment decisions.
